Bel-Red
Meta, Microsoft and Overlake Medical
Some of the Seattle area's biggest companies are here, making for a quick commute. Meta's Spring District campus is located in the neighborhood, Amazon and Coca-Cola have facilities here and the Microsoft Headquarters is a few miles away in Redmond. On the west side of Bel-Red, Overlake Medical Center is a nonprofit hospital with an emergency room, in addition to being a major employer.Spring District, a brewery and restaurants

Bel-Red Station, Route 520 and I-405
The main thoroughfare of the neighborhood is 12th Street, which eventually turns into Bel-Red Road, and can be used to reach neighboring Redmond. There are plenty of bus stops, notably along Bel-Red Road. Sound Transit's light rail East Link Extension added eight new stations from South Bellevue to Redmond. The BelRed Station has 300 parking spaces. The station is an anchor for the BelRed Arts District, a designated area that supports creative businesses and arts organizations.With a junction in the northwest section of Bel-Red, state Route 520 and I-405 provide convenient routes north, south, east or west. Sea-Tac, Seattle-Tacoma International Airport, is approximately 20 miles away.
Limited inventory, Lake Bellevue Village Condos
Since the community is primarily commercial, there's limited housing inventory. Single-family homes here feature new construction, are over 3,400 square feet, and cost over $2.5 million. Condos and townhouses are priced from about $515,000 to $1.3 million. The Lake Bellevue Village Condos encircling the lake are within walking distance of waterside businesses and eateries and go for approximately $650,000 to $775,000.Grade A for Odle Middle and Sammamish High
Public school students may attend Stevenson Elementary School, which has a B-minus grade from Niche and offers a Spanish dual-language program. Odle Middle School has an A grade, as does Sammamish High, which includes dual enrollment classes that count as college credits for Bellevue College, a CNA Health Science Career program and robotics courses. Jing Mei Elementary is considered a choice school; it provides dual-language Chinese immersion with a lottery system for enrollment.Several private schools are also located in Bel-Red, including Dartmoor School, Bellevue Children's Academy and America's Child Montessori.
Highland Park, Bridle Trails State Park
Highland Park is a hub for outdoor activities, with fields, tennis courts, and both indoor and outdoor skate parks. The Highland Community Center provides engaging activities and an adaptive recreation program for people with disabilities.Nearby is the Bellevue Family YMCA. A few miles north is the 489-acre Bridle Trails State Park. Its 28 miles of multiuse trails are popular with hikers and horse riders.
Bellevue Arts Fair and a bluegrass festival
Bel-Red folks may attend annual area events like the springtime Bellevue Arts Fair, the Northwest's largest arts and crafts festival. Fall brings Bellevue Fashion Week, the Bellevue Jazz & Blues Music Series and the Wintergrass Bluegrass Music Festival. A regional favorite, Seafair, is a summer festival with hydroplane races, a half marathon, a triathlon, a parade and airshows featuring the Blue Angels.
